
Well boys, we had our 9th annual teal hunt this past weekend in my home town of El Campo, Tx, and had 11 disabled hunters come in for the weekend. 2 guys were new injuries and it was their first time back in the field. We had 8 different landowners and several volunteers who gave up their time to help guide our hunters.
After a roast duck dinner on Friday at the Texana Seed Co. in Garwood, hunters were paired with their guides and friendships were either made or rekindled. Also, we worked with some of the hunters who needed some "on-the-spot" adaptive equipment work to test out on the hunts.
In 2 days, the group downed about 85 ducks in all, and everyone saw good action. For some, just getting out was the most important accomplishment. They got to see that some things are still possible even after traumatic injuries.
Next year will be our 10th anniversary and I know it'll be a great one!
